Why universal basic income still canβt meet the challenges of an AI economy
15 December 2025 at 07:00
Andrew Yangβs revived pitch suits the automation debate, but UBI canβt fix inequalities concentrated tech wealth drives
Universal basic income (UBI) is back, like a space zombie in a sci-fi movie, resurrected from policy oblivion, hungry for policymakersβ attention: brains!
Andrew Yang, whose βYang Gangβ enthusiasm briefly shook up the Democratic presidential nomination in 2020 promoting a βFreedom Dividendβ to save workers from automation β $1,000 a month for every American adult β is again the main carrier of the bug: offering UBI to save the nation when robots eat all our jobs.
